19" Linea Corse rims
I was planning to buy a second hand 19" Linea Corse Avant lightweight rims which's having the following spec:
Rim specs: 19" Linea Corse
Bolt pattern: 5x114.3
Width: 8.5 inches all around with about 1" lip
Offset: +35mm
Will they fit easily into my LS430, HALF Ultra, cause i am now running the OEM 18".

if you're worried about the fitment, it should fit with no problem.
but clearing the brake caliper is the main issue (as mentioned below) for most wheels since the brake caliper is pretty big
Quote:
Originally Posted by
caddyowner
Will a +35 offset clear the brake calipers? Isn't stock like +45? Personally, I don't care for the spoke pattern on that particular wheel.
offsets do not determine whether or not they will clear the brakes.
it's the shape of the inside spokes-look for high disc

Make sure it has "high disk"/BBK clearance on the spokes. If not, you'll need about 15mm of spacer and you may have fender rubbing issues. In addition with the fronts, the rears will also need spacers to make the fitment match.
